Police are looking for help to find the person who stole funds from a poppy donation box at the Simcoe Legion.
SIMCOE - A disheartening story out of Simcoe today as a poppy donation box was stolen from the Legion on West Street.
Norfolk OPP say the crime happened sometime between Monday and Wednesday morning. The poppy donation box was taken from the counter of the bar area. Police say the person who stole the money took the box to the bathroom when no one was looking, stole the cash and left the poppies scattered in the washroom.
"Our veterans have played such an integral role in Canadian history and society, and this act of theft is very disturbing. The OPP are seeking the public’s assistance with this investigation. If anyone has any information regarding this incident they are being asked to contact the Norfolk County OPP Detachment at 1-888-310-1122", comments Constable Ed Sanchuk, Norfolk County OPP.
